The concept of the idea-expression dichotomy is a foundational principle in copyright law, designed to maintain a delicate equilibrium between fostering creativity and safeguarding intellectual property. This doctrine differentiates between the fundamental ideas and the specific way these ideas are presented, acknowledging that ideas themselves are not subject to copyright protection but the distinctive and tangible manifestations of those ideas. Copyright law is in place to protect the original and concrete manners in which ideas are communicated, not the ideas in their abstract form. This principle is pivotal in stimulating innovation and preventing monopolies over elementary concepts or themes. When ideas and expressions become indistinguishable, there is what's known as a merger, and this may preclude the granting of copyright protection. Implementing this dichotomy can be challenging for courts, especially in intricate cases concerning literature, art, cinema, and software. They must ascertain whether the copyrighted work contains safeguarded expressions or merely embodies unshielded ideas. The criteria for defining what qualifies as a protected expression can be complex contingent on the work's level of abstraction and detail. This article will discuss the history and origin of the Idea- Expression Dichotomy, the laws that are provided from an Indian perspective, and their exceptions.

Temples are a crucial archeological source of information for the study of ancient Indian history. As we talk about the ancient India, the Cholas happen to be a crucial yet underestimated dynasty in India. The chola dynasty reigned in the southern part of India during the period of 8th century to 13th century AD, however the earliest traces of cholas are found as early as 3rd century BCE. A prominent king of the empire was Rajendra Chola. He was a military might and naval genius. Started as a commander to his father's army, he as an imperialist, occupied lands of Sri Lanka, laccadives, Maldives, Cambodia, Thailand and Peru. But his military power was not the only great thing. Rajendra chola was also a patron of art and architecture. The south India during this period had a rich culture and heritage. Temples were a part of it. The prominent style of temple architecture was the Dravidian style which is why it is also called a south Indian school of architecture. Though the Dravidian style was started by the pallavas, chola kings like Rajaraja chola and his son, Rajendra Chola had followed the Dravidian style of architecture in their temples. The temples built by the kings are a crucial and a undeniable source of information. Therefore it makes the temples built by the great king Rajendra chola important to history. King Rajendra Chola built the Brihadisvara temple at his new temple Gangaikonda Cholapurum to celebrate his victory in the plains of the Ganges. So in the following paper is an attempt to evaluate the temple that was built under the kingship of rajendra Chola.

The IoT-Based crop monitoring System is a cutting-edge solution designed to enhance agricultural productivity and efficiency by utilizing sensor technology and automation. The core objective is to automate the irrigation process based on real-time soil moisture data. The systememploysanESP8266 module to facilitate the seamless exchange of data between various sensors and Firebase, a real-time cloud database. This interconnected system comprises two primary fields, each equipped with soil and soil moisture sensors, temperature sensors, smoke detectors, UV light, buzzer, solenoid valves, and mini water pump. The ESP8266 module serves as the central hub for collecting data from the sensors and transmitting it to the Firebase database. The data includes crucial information such as soil moisture levels, temperature, smoke detection, and UV light intensity. Furthermore, the system integrates alarm functionality through the buzzer and precise irrigation control via the solenoid valve and mini water pump. The data stored in Firebase is accessible through a web application built using React.js and Node.js. This web interface provides users with a graphical representation of the gathered data, allowing them to monitor the agricultural conditions in real-time. Users can view historical data trends, set thresholds, and receive alerts in case of unfavorable conditions, such as low soil moisture levels or unusual temperature fluctuations. The main key features are Data Visualization in which users can remotely monitor soil moisture levels and receive real-time updates on crop conditions through a web application. User Control in this the system allows users to adjust moisture thresholds and irrigation schedules, providing flexibility and customization. Resource Efficiency by automating irrigation, this model optimizes water usage, reducing waste and improving water conservation. This paper not only showcases the integration of IoT technology in agriculture but also serves as a practical and environmentally responsible solution for modern farming practices.
